A HAWICK man will stand trial next month on a charge of assaulting a man to his severe injury and permanent disfigurement in a Galashiels pub.
Colin Richardson, of Charles Street, denies headbutting the man and causing him to fall to the floor.
The 20-year-old also denies repeatedly punching him on the head and body whereby he was rendered unconscious.
The alleged assault is said to have taken place in the Gluepot in Overhaugh Street, on October 31, 2015.
A trial has been set for Selkirk Sheriff Court on June 12.
